1.The Research on Kinetic Parameters of Gait Analysis in Patients with Knee Osteoarthritis
Wei LI ; Jingbin ZHOU ; Zengyu TAO ; Guoping LI
Chinese Journal of Sports Medicine 2010;(3):268-271
Objective To investigate the changes in kinetic parameters of the major joints of the lower extremity during walking in patients with knee osteoarthritis(KOA),and explore its mechanism for clinical treatment.Methods Sixty patients with KOA in tibia-femoral joint and 30 healthy persons as control group(CON) were recruited.Patients were divided into less severe KOA group(LKOA)and more severe KOA group(MKOA)in accordance to K/L radiological grade,then the kinetic data by 3D-gait analysis system were collect.Results LKOA had more knee maximal abduction movement than MKOA and CON after heel strike(P<0.001);the knee first peak adduction movement of MKOA was significantly greater than LKOA(P<0.05)and CON(P<0.001)during medial stance phase;the knee second peak adduction movement of LKOA was significantly less than CON(P<0.05);the hip first peak adduction movement of MKOA was significantly greater than CON(P<0.05).Conclusion The more severe level of KOA in tibia-femoral joint,the more load on medial compartment of patient's knees was seen,comparing with CON,patients with KOA have greater hip abduction movement and more severe patients have less hip adduction movement.
2.The value of the thumper cardiopulmouary resuscitator in the emergency cardiopulmonary resuscltation
Qian CHEN ; Xin WEI ; Huiping WANG ; Hongfeng YAN ; Dandan WU ; Weibo WU ; Lan LIANG ; Zengyu XIE
Chinese Journal of Postgraduates of Medicine 2009;32(1):27-29
Objective To evaluate the value of the thumper cardiopulmonary resuscitator in the emergency cardiopulmonary resuscitation(CPR).Methods Fifty cardiac mspiratory sudden stop patients with thumper cardiopulmonary resuscitator from January 2004 to December 2007 were recruited into treatment group,and 80 cardiac respiratory sudden stop patients with barehanded CPR from May 2000 to December 2003 were recruited into control group.The SBP and blood oxygen saturation 5 to 10 minutes after the resuscitation was compared.The rate of restoration of spontaneous circulation(ROSC),hospitalization and the complication in the two groups was compared.Results The treatment group was better than the control group in improving the SBP and blood oxygen saturation(P<0.05).The rates of ROSC and hospitalization in the treatment group were higher than those in the control group(44%,40%and 25%,21%).P<0.05.The rate of complications had no significant difference between the two groups.Conclusions Thumper cardiopulmonary resuscitator Can surmount the factors of medical staff or patients.It can make the CPR more standard andmore effective.MeanwhileitCan raisethe SBP,strokevolume and blood supplv to the heart and brain,and then mcrease the successful rate of CPR.
3.The predictive value of the neutrophils/lymphocytes ratio combined with random blood glucose in sepsis
Guangwei YU ; Zengjie LIN ; Fuquan TU ; Qiuying ZHENG ; Jingnan XIANG ; Zengyu WEI ; Wenwei WU ; Xiaohong LIN
Chinese Journal of Emergency Medicine 2024;33(5):636-642
Objective:To explore the predictive value of the neutrophil-to-lymphocyte ratio (NLR) combined with blood glucose at admission for a positive blood culture for sepsis.Methods:A single-center retrospective cohort study was conducted. According to the 2016 American Society of Critical Care/European Society of Critical Care Medicine (SCCM/ESICM) and diagnostic criteria for sepsis and septic shock-3.0 (sepsis-3.0), patients with sepsis were admitted to the Emergency Department of Fujian Medical University Union Hospital for more than 24 h from January 2019 to December 2021 were enrolled. Age, gender, sequential organ failure assessment, source of infection, NLR, and blood culture results were recorded. Based on the blood culture results, patients were divided into a blood culture positive group (Gram-positive group, Gram-negative group) and blood culture negative group, and the differences between the groups were compared. The risk factors for a positive blood culture were analyzed using multivariate logistic regression. A receiver operating characteristic analysis was performed for the NLR combined with the blood glucose measurement.Results:A total of 265 patients with sepsis were included, of which 62 were positive in blood culture (15 Gram-positive patients, 37 Gram-negative patients and 10 fungal patients). The positive rate of blood culture was 23.4%. The number of patients with history of diabetes, neutrophil count, procalcitonin, blood glucose, and NLR in the positive blood culture group were significantly higher than those in the negative blood culture group (all P<0.001). Multivariate logistic regression analysis revealed that random admission blood glucose ( OR=1.116, 95% CI: 1.051~1.186, P<0.001) and NLR ( OR=1.039, 95% CI: 1.015~1.064, P=0.001) were independent risk factors for blood culture positivity in sepsis patients. For patients with blood culture positive, and with Gram-negative bacterial bloodstream infections, the AUC of the NLR combined with the admission blood glucose level was 0.819 (95% CI: 0.761-0.877, P<0.001) and 0.871 (95% CI: 0.813-0.928, P<0.001), respectively. Conclusions:The combination of NLR and random admission blood glucose could provide a good predictive value for blood culture positive and gram-negative bacterial bloodstream infections in sepsis patients.
